The Emergence of Online Fishing Communities
Online fishing communities have burgeoned across various platforms, providing a digital sanctuary for fishing enthusiasts. These communities serve as virtual cafes where people gather to exchange tips, share experiences, and showcase their catches. The ability to connect with a global audience provides unique insights and fosters a sense of camaraderie among members.
Websites and social media platforms are teaming with groups dedicated to fishing. From local clubs to international organizations, the availability of online venues empowers individuals to learn from seasoned anglers and explore diverse techniques. Moreover, forums and discussion boards offer a wealth of information on fishing locations, bait recommendations, and equipment reviews.

Technological Innovations in Online Fishing
Technology has played a pivotal role in the evolution of online fishing. From high-quality virtual environments that replicate real-world fishing experiences to apps and websites offering real-time fishing forecasts, the integration of digital tools has been transformative. One popular example is the use of virtual reality (VR), which allows users to experience the thrill of fishing in a truly immersive way.
Anglers can venture into virtual lakes, rivers, and oceans and use realistic gestures to cast their lines and reel in catches. This technology not only serves as an entertainment medium but also as a valuable educational tool, offering beginners an opportunity to practice fishing techniques before heading out to the waters.

Embracing Sustainability and Conservation
Amidst the growth of online fishing, there is an increasing emphasis on promoting sustainable and ethical fishing practices. Online platforms are pivotal in disseminating information about the importance of conservation and responsible fishing. This information helps foster awareness and collective action towards preserving aquatic ecosystems.
Routine discussions in online forums often tackle topics such as catch-and-release best practices, the impact of overfishing, and the protection of endangered species. By bringing these issues to the forefront, online fishing communities contribute to the cultivation of an environmental ethos that respects the fragile balance of aquatic life.
